But there
is one thing, one experience as a book blogger I love most and still think
about a lot. For my birthday a view years ago, my husband surprised me with a
trip to London. It was a one day trip, and although being in London would have
been enough.. he arranged a meeting and tour through the offices of the Little,
Brown Book Group. I had been receiving books from them for a while then, but I
never thought I would be able to visit their office. But I did. And it was
amazing.
was it super fun to see their work space, and to see where they put all there
books. But I was also allowed to pick some books to take home with me. I
definitely thought I died and went to heaven. It was amazing. And truly my favorite
book blogger experience.
